The Rise of Automated Insights
One standout company at the forefront of this innovation is AP (Associated Press), which introduced its Automated Insights product in 2014. This tool uses advanced algorithms to analyze data from sports events, generating detailed game recaps and player performance summaries in real-time. Enhancing Quality with Sportradar's AI Engine
Another major player is Sportradar, whose AI Engine combines data aggregation and natural language processing to create engaging sports content. This technology can generate a wide range of articles, from breaking news updates to in-depth analysis pieces, all tailored to specific audience preferences. Challenges and Future Outlook
Despite the numerous benefits, there are challenges associated with AI-driven content creation. Ensuring that the automated pieces maintain a human touch and avoid algorithmic bias is crucial for maintaining credibility with readers. Companies like AP and Sportradar are continuously working to refine their algorithms to address these concerns.
